Heidi Latsky: A Dancemaker’s Journey
Choreographer Heidi Latsky is best known for her pioneering work "The GIMP Project," which features disabled and nondisabled dancers. Having presented "GIMP" to tremendous acclaim in 2010, CHF brings back its creator to reflect on a remarkable career that has taken her from principal dancer in Bill T. Jones’s company to boundary-pushing dancemaker.
